Green Crest Golf Club
Played On 06/17/2023Lot’s of potential, but painfully slow
We’ve played here a few times and on balance we liked it and will come back. I think the front nine is more interesting than the back, but both have a couple of really unique holes. It was a Saturday before Father’s Day so no surprise that it took our foursome 6 hours to play 18 holes.
There is a starter but no ranger that I saw all day. A lot of younger adults come out for a day of drinking and golf and sometimes that slows things down. We had a “6 some” in front of us. They teed off the first hole as two threesomes, but quickly joined up and all played together. The front nine took over 3 hours, but the back was a bit quicker.
I think there are some things they could do to help pace of play. Should never let a single or twosome go out on the weekend. Hire a ranger to keep an eye on things. The people who work here are all great and very friendly. It’s a long course and can fool you on a number of holes. Par 5 over 500 yards, some Par 4’s 400 yards or greater. If I compare this course to other municipal courses it is a much better course than some and I’d play here before playing at other muni’s in the area.

Hawk's Landing Golf Club
Played On 02/20/2022Always a good time at Hawks Landing
My wife and I play here almost every time we are in Orlando. This is probably the third time we've played this year. The golf course has evolved over the years and is now a par 70 (18th hole used to be a par 5, now a 3). But we enjoy the convenience and have generally played with really nice people., There are some tricky holes like the first par 5. It looks more intimidating than it is, but it's still one that you have to think about each shot. The 7th is a very long par 3. Even from the Blue Tees it's a poke! The back actually has more "fun" holes, where ball placement is everything. I love all three of the par 3's on the back, especially 18. I love the island green and I think it looks like the 17th at the Stadium Course. The course has a lot of miles on it and it shows in a few areas like the Tee Boxes. But always a fun round.

Dubsdread Golf Course
Played On 02/12/2021A hidden gem in the middle of Downtown Orlando
I had never played here and based on this one experience I would definitely return. The course has a lot of water (almost every hole) that comes into play on most shots, particularly drives. The greens were very good, but also quite fast. They have a nice golf range and a really nice restaurant on property for an after round meal. Pricing is in line with expectations for a municipal course. Overall course condition is in line with a well used muni course. But the fareways, greens and most T boxes were in good shape. If you approach this course as a very solid muni I think you will have a good time.
